Luxury, space, and poolside living come together at 7164 N Crest Ct, ideally positioned on the DC/eastern side of Warrenton. Set on 1.23 acres in Lake Whippoorwill, this brick Colonial offers over 4,500 finished square feet with 4 bedrooms, 3 full baths, 1 half bath, and a flexible three-level layout with room to live, work, host, and expand. Major updates buyers care about are already in place, including a roof replaced approximately 3 years ago, a renovated high-end kitchen with a custom feel, and a luxury primary bath with a spa-like finish. The home features generous living areas, a fireplace, four upper-level bedrooms, a main-level office/flex room with potential as an additional bedroom option, and a fully finished lower level offering recreation/living space plus potential for (another) additional bedroom setup. Outside, the in-ground pool creates a private resort-style setting for summer living, entertaining, and everyday relaxation. A side-entry 2-car garage, cul-de-sac setting, and expansive lot further enhance the property. Minutes to Gainesville and Haymarket with convenient access to Route 29/15 and I-66, this is a standout DC-side Warrenton opportunity offering acreage, major lifestyle upgrades, pool living, and Northern Virginia convenience.
